Elementum项目使用与配置指南
1. 项目的目录结构及介绍
Elementum是一个基于Kodi的视频流媒体插件,其目录结构如下:
plugin.video.elementum/
├── .gitattributes
├── .gitignore
├── .gitmodules
├── BUILD.md
├── LICENSE
├── Makefile
├── README.md
├── addon.xml
├── bundle.sh
├── fanart.jpg
├── fanart.png
├── icon-menu.png
├── icon.png
├── navigation.py
├── release.sh
├── requirements.txt
├── service.py
├── setup.cfg
├── whatsnew.txt
└── resources/
├── ...
addon.xml
:定义插件的元数据和入口点。service.py
:插件的后端服务,负责处理主要的逻辑。navigation.py
:定义插件的界面和导航。requirements.txt
:项目依赖的Python库。resources/
:包含插件的资源文件,如图像和样式表。LICENSE
:项目的许可证信息。
2. 项目的启动文件介绍
项目的启动文件是service.py
。这个文件负责初始化插件的后端服务,并且是插件运行的入口点。它定义了插件如何与Kodi的API交互,并且处理用户的各种操作请求。
# service.py 的部分代码示例
import xbmc
import xbmcgui
import xbmcplugin
addon = xbmcaddon.Addon('plugin.video.elementum')
translation = xbmc.getLocalizedString
# Kodi插件服务的入口点
if __name__ == '__main__':
Elementum().run()
3. 项目的配置文件介绍
Elementum的配置主要通过Kodi的设置界面进行。用户可以通过以下步骤访问和配置插件:
- 打开Kodi,进入设置菜单。
- 选择“服务设置”。
- 选择“控制”。
- 在“应用程序控制”下启用相应的选项。
插件的具体配置选项包括自动选择流、流的下载位置、是否在观看后保留文件等。这些配置都存储在用户的Kodi配置文件中。
此外,requirements.txt
文件中列出的Python库也是项目配置的一部分,它们确保了项目依赖的正确安装和版本兼容性。
请注意,对于具体的配置细节,应当参考项目的README.md
文件和Kodi的官方文档,以获得更多指导和帮助。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考